When sorting numbers in a col, they come out 1, 10, 11, 2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9. How can I make them come out 1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,10,11? Thank you, Ironsides

What is the fastest way to copy a formula?
If A2:A50000 contain data. Enter a formula in B2. Select B2. Double-click the Fill Handle and Excel will shoot the formula down to B50000.

Sounds to me that Excel isn't actually recognising the values as numbers.

Where are the numbers coming from?
 
Upvote 0
thanks Norie, of course, the col was Text not number. Changing it to number fixed it. ( blush blush blush )
